MSSQL双向发布——实现跨地域数据交换(mssql 双向发布)

2023-04-20 20:03:20 发布 双向 地域

MSSQL双向发布可以实现跨地域数据交换,它能够实现两个不同地域的数据库之间的同步。它是一种分布式数据复制工具,可以有效地让相互之间分布式扩展,加速应用程序的计算性能以及降低存储成本。下面是实现MSSQL双向发布跨地域数据交换的几步基本过程:

第一步:将MSSQL服务器连接到你的云账户。您可以使用SQL Server Management Studio来访问MSSQL服务器,并创建必要的数据库实例。

第二步:配置MSSQL双向发布,将一个MSSQL实例和另一个实例之间的双向发布连接。这可以使用MSSQL Server Management Studio execu Transact-SQL statements来实现。例如可以使用以下代码创建数据库发布:

CREATE PUBLICATION MyFirstPublication

AS PART OF Snapshot

FOR ALL TABLES;

第三步:在另一个实例上创建订阅。用于从另一个实例上发布所有数据库的表的接收订阅。例如可以使用以下代码来创建订阅:

CREATE SUBSCRIPTION MyFirstSubscription

FOR MyfirstPublication

WITH

INITIALIZE_FROM_CURRENT_SNAPSHOT

SYNCHRONIZATION;

第四步:配置MSSQL双向发布。一旦订阅者创建,就可以使用MSSQL语句来配置双向发布,以便更新或传播订阅者到地域群组之间进行数据交换。

当MSSQL双向发布配置完成后,你就可以实现跨地域的数据交换共享。 MSSQL双向发布可以实现跨地域数据交换可以显著提高每个数据传输的吞吐量,减少等待时间,减少地理位置感知解决方案的复杂性,便于应用跨多个层级的分布式系统的数据库系统的维护。

相关文章